The empire strikes back !

The avionics company Bendix/King was displaced from the position it held for so long at the very top of the GA avionics market by Garmin with a product that offerd a lot of showroom performance and filled the market for the replacement of those old KX170/175 nav/com's to a tee.

Well it would seem that the sleeping giant has awoken and is about to put it's self back at the very top of GA avionics market.

If you are looking for a new avionic fit then check out the KNS770 GPS/NAV/COM and the KFD840 PFD on the Bendix/King website, I am told that the prices are well below that of the rest of the market.

I have yet to check the ability of these units to interconnect with other products as this requires a look at the instalation manuals but if past reputation is anything to go by these units will offer "real world" performance even when conected to other manufacturers equipment.
